Craig Gordon saves Steve Bruce a new signing
STEVE Bruce has shelved plans to strengthen Sunderland's goalkeeping department after hailing Craig Gordon for rediscovering the form that made him Britain's most expensive stopper.
After an injury-ravaged campaign that saw him play just 12 Premier League games for the Black Cats last season there were question marks surrounding his long-term Stadium of Light future - with Bruce going as far as drawing up a shortlist of possible replacements.
Gordon's slow recovery from a knee operation meant that it was an understandable back-up plan, but after a series of fine displays since regaining the number one jersey, Bruce's worries have been eased.
